I am an adult women who wears 6.5 USA standard shoe size. In kids shoes I'm typically a 4.5, but these run a bit small, so exchanged for a 5.5 USA size. A 5 would have been a better fit.I bought about 5 different types of DC brand shoes all the same size and they all fit a little differently. But, I exchanged them with no issue and got a pair that's just a tad too big now instead. I just use insoles and extra socks when it's cold, so it works out.They are awesome, I use them as work shoes in the Art Department on commercial sets.

My kids aren’t hard on shoes. This is after 2 1/2 months and they have not been worn daily. I have always loved the DC brand and know them to be better quality than this. I now have to fork out even more money than I should have had to since school starts in 2 weeks.
Bought skate shoes figuring that they would hold up to kid use. Worn only on the school and playground. Didn’t make it 2 months.
Size guide on the listing is not correct. It doesn't break down sizes in big kids and little kids and claims a US size 3 is 22 inches heel to toe. I don't know any kid, big or little, with a 22 inch long foot. Shaq's shoes are 16 inches long. Was going to purchase but I can't now because these shows are for giant children.
